What is a remote international school counselor?

Remote International School Counselors are professionals who provide academic, social-emotional, and career guidance to students enrolled in international schools, but they do so remotely using digital communication tools. They support students from diverse cultural backgrounds and often collaborate with teachers, parents, and administrators across different time zones. Their responsibilities may include counseling sessions, college and career planning, crisis intervention, and helping students adapt to new environments. This role requires strong communication skills, cultural sensitivity, and familiarity with international education systems.

How does a remote international school counselor effectively support students across different time zones and cultures?

As a remote international school counselor, supporting students in various time zones and cultural backgrounds requires flexible scheduling, strong digital communication skills, and cultural sensitivity. Counselors often use virtual platforms to host meetings, workshops, and one-on-one sessions, adapting their hours to accommodate students and families from different regions. Building rapport and trust remotely involves being proactive, regularly checking in, and staying mindful of cultural norms and expectations. Collaboration with teachers, administrators, and parents is essential to provide holistic support, despite the physical distance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ote international school counselor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ote International School Counselor, you need a background in counseling or psychology, relevant certifications (such as a school counseling license), and experience working with diverse student populations. Familiarity with virtual counseling platforms, online learning management systems, and secure communication tools is essential. Strong cultural sensitivity, active listening, and clear communication skills set outstanding counselors apart in remote, multicultural settings. These skills enable effective student support, foster well-being, and help navigate the unique challenges of international and remote education environments.
